6 Claims. (Cl. 19-120) The invention relates to combing machines of the Heilmann type and has for its principal objection the provision of an improved mounting for the lower nipper or cushion plate.
It has been proposed heretofore to mount the cushion plate so that it, or a spring plate associated with it, partakes of an upward or rocking movement serving to lift the fringe for penetration by the top comb needles as the upper nipper, or nipper knife, is raised during the forward movement of the nipper assembly but such arrangements have been somewhat complex, mechanically, in some instances, and in other instances the relatively moving parts have been so disposed and located that their operation has been impaired by lint and fly accumulation which has had to be removed frequently to ensure continued operation without impairment of the uniform quality of the sliver.
The principal object of the present invention is to provide a rocking type of cushion plate mounting which is of simple construction and which lends itself to trouble free operation.

Referring preliminarily to Fig. 1 of the drawings, the reference 10 indicatesthe usual oscillating wag shaft by which the nippers are advanced toward and retracted from the detaching rolls 11 disposed above the needles 12 of comb cylinder 13. The upper nipper, or nipper knife, is marked 14, the lower nipper, or cushion plate 15 and the top comb needles 16.
The nipper frame comprises side portions 20 connected by a transversely disposed body portion, generally designated 21. The details of the manner of supporting the illustrated nipper frame form no part of the present invention and, hence, will not be described.
The nipper frame incorporates transversely extending pivot means on which are mounted supporting means for the cushion plate, so that it may partake of a rocking The lower stop face of the cushion platesupport' is the heel or under surface 30 of the support, at the rear of the cushion plate; and the lower stop of the nipper frame for engagement by the lower stop face is the face or shoulder 31 of the nipper frame body portion 21.
The upper stop face of the cushion plate support is the top surface 32 of a boss 33 disposed centrally and formed as an integral part of the upstanding portion 26 of the support; and the upper stop of the nipper frame is a depending screw 34 mounted in the overhanging front end 35 of a bracket 36 which, at its lower end 37, is secured to the rear face of the nipper frame body portion by bolt 38. As will be apparent, the screw 34 is adjustable to vary the extent of the upward rocking movement of the cushion plate and its support about the axis of pivot shafts 23.
The unit consisting of the cushion plate and its support is spring-biased upwardly to engage the upper stop face with the upper stop. For this purpose, recesses or pockets 45 (Fig. 4) are formed in bosses 46 which, like 33, are formed integrally with the upstanding portion 26 of the cushion plate support. The lower or open ends of recesses 45 are disposed in the stop face 30 of the support, so that the lower ends of springs 47 mounted in the recesses engage the lower stop 31 of the nipper frame body portion.
In operation, the descending nipper knife engages the toe of the cushion plate and, compressing springs 47, rocks it and its support to the Fig. 1 position. During the forward movement of the nipper assembly (that is, towards the detaching rolls 11) the nipper knife rises and permits springs 47 to rock the support and cushion plate upwardly to the extent permitted by step screw 34, the
nipper knife and cushion plate assuming the positions in.
dicated in broken lines in Fig. 1. Thus, the rising cushion plate lifts the fringe to the top comb needles and, as will be apparent, the degree of penetration of the fringe by the needles is readily controlled by adjusting screw 34.
As will be seen, the stops and stop faces are all disposed rearwardly of the rear end of the cushion plate and hence are remote from the bite or active zone of the nippers where lint and fly tend to accumulate; and, .consequently, there is little danger of the lint or fly accumulating to excess in the region of the stops and stop faces where it would tend to clog the rocking movement of the cushion plate and hence impair the quality of the sliver.
